I disagree about Kanu.

I remember EXACTLY how Kanu played when he retired.

Yes he was not at the top of HIS game, but he was better than the rest of the squad! It is not the case with Musa who is not needed.

How did Kanu play at the end? He was old, sluggish and tired, but his technique on the ball was of such high quality that NOT A SINGLE player on the team came even remotely close to being at his level of technique. He had better vision than everyone else, he held the ball up better than everyone else, he pivoted better than everyone else, his passing was better than everyone else.

Kanu, I repeat was Nigeria's best player technically, when he retired. If you don't believe me, go back and watch the matches.
